The process of reverting an application on the Android operating system to a previous iteration can be essential for users encountering compatibility issues, performance degradation, or undesirable changes introduced by a more recent update. For example, an application update might introduce a bug affecting core functionality, leading users to seek a more stable, earlier version.
Returning to a former application version can restore functionality, improve device responsiveness, and circumvent unwanted feature alterations. This practice addresses situations where user experience is negatively impacted by new releases, offering control over software environments. Historically, the need arose alongside the increasing frequency of application updates and the potential for unforeseen consequences stemming from these updates.